Identify Underlying Issues


When you clean your drain once a month, you can recognize underlying concerns before they become major issues. For example, if you discover particles coming out of your washroom drains pipes with a snake cleaner, they could be wearing away. Any kind of atypical things appearing of a drain should raise issues. If it is not just the normal hair as well as gunk, you need to call a plumber to see if your washroom drains pipes requirement to be repaired.

Prevent Bad Odors


There is absolutely nothing more humiliating than a foul-smelling washroom. Obstructed drains can cause bacteria to accumulate, leading to pungent smells. A professional plumber can not just unblock your drain however also deodorise it. You can pour hot water and also bleach down the tubes to remove several of the bad smells, but that is only a short-lived repair.

Prevent Obstructions


Among the most apparent reasons for cleansing your restroom drains pipes on a monthly basis is to prevent clogs. A whole lot a lot more goes down the drainpipe than you would certainly believe-- skin flakes, eyelashes, dirt, and also hair. Every one of these bits build up and at some point trigger blockages. Also a minor obstruction can make your sink or shower basically unusable. When you tidy your drains pipes routinely, you will certainly not end up with deep clogs that require solid chemicals and expert equipment. While you can clean your shower room drains by yourself, we suggest that you call a plumber to skillfully cleanse your drains a few times annually.

Faster Draining


Do you hate the sensation of standing in a couple of inches of water in the shower? A slow-draining sink or shower is an excellent sign that you require to clean the pipelines. When you tidy your drains monthly, you need to never ever need to fret about slow-draining sinks or showers. Not just that, however faster-draining pipes assist maintain your sink as well as shower cleaner.

Stop Comprehensive Damages


As stated, frequently cleaning your washroom drains pipes can help identify underlying problems that are a lot more serious than a sink blocked with hair. The average cost to repair a drainpipe line is $696, which is a lot more expensive than the simple $10 it takes to cleanse your drains regular monthly. Significant obstructions can harm your whole plumbing system and also also have an effect on the general public systems as well as the quality of water.

HOW OFTEN SHOULD DRAINS BE CLEANED?


You rinse off your dishes after a meal and notice that water pools in the kitchen sink as you load the dishwasher. You brush your teeth and the bathroom sink is slow to drain. You take a shower and dirty water pools at your feet – all of these are signs that your home has clogged drains!



A lot of people don’t think about their drains until there’s a problem, that’s the main reason why they put maintenance on the backburner. If they’re smart, they’ll get the clogged fixed and clean their drains and they’ll have them re-cleaned as a preventative measure in a couple of years.



Hate getting that unexpected clog the night you’re hosting a dinner to your 10 closest friends? Afraid your kitchen sink will get clogged on Thanksgiving? Afraid your shower will clog when your mother-in-law visits for a week? Getting your drains cleaned regularly is the only way to prevent surprise clogs that always seem to occur at the worst times.


Not everyone is at the same risk for a clogged drain; there are definite factors that increase the risk. For example, if you live in an old home with original plumbing, chances are, your pipes have taken a beating. If you're a landlord and you rent out your second home, your renters may be pouring the grease down your kitchen sink because “it’s just a rental.”



If you cook at home and constantly using your garbage disposal instead of throwing food waste in the trash, ground-up food from the disposal could be depositing large amounts of sludge and debris into the pipes, which can be slowly restricting water flow until a clog becomes inevitable. If you’re not being cautious and you’re grinding up eggshells, coffee grounds, rice, pasta, potato peels, carrots, and celery, a clog can surprise you at any moment.



The two major reasons for clogs are your habits and behaviors! For example, you’re at a higher risk for clogged drains if you don’t have a dishwasher. If your drains are clogging every month, it’s wise to get them cleaned right away. As for maintenance, we recommend cleaning them every two years, but we may suggest more frequent cleanings if you have a large household and use the sinks a lot.
